If Your OPPO Phone is Always On Speaker when Answering Calls
Applicable products:SmartphonesSystem version:All system versions
If Your OPPO Phone is Always On Speaker When Answering Calls If your calls are being answered in speaker mode by default, and cannot be switched to receiver, there might be a system or hardware issue. Try the following simple steps below to fix that. Note: Check your ColorOS version in [Settings] > [About Phone] / [About Device]. Always on speaker when answering calls Follow the troubleshooting guide below if your OPPO phone is always on speaker when you're answering calls. Turn on/off the switch to the receiver For ColorOS 12 to ColorOS 13 and above: Go to [Settings] > [System settings] / [Additional settings] > [Gestures & motions] > [Auto switch to receiver]. For ColorOS 7 to 11: Go to [Settings] > [Convenience tools] > [Gestures & motions] > [Auto switch to receiver]. For ColorOS 6.0 to 6.1: Go to [Settings] > [Convenience Aid] > [Gesture & Motion] > [Smart Call] > [Mode Switching during Calls]. For ColorOS 5.0 to 5.2: Go to [Settings] > [Smart & Convenient] > [Gesture & Motion] > [Smart Call] > [Switch to Speaker for Calls] / [Mode Switching during Calls]. For ColorOS 3.2 and below: Go to [Settings] > [Gesture & Motion] > [Smart Call] > [Switch to Speaker for Calls]. Check third-party call-recorder app Check if any third-party Call Recorder app is installed on your phone and the automatic speaker is on. If yes, go to the settings of the third-party call recorder app and turn off the automatic speaker. Check your headset If sound comes out of the speakers even when headsets are plugged in, check the headsets for any damage, or check the headset jack for obstructions. Restart your OPPO phone Press and hold the Power and the Volume Up buttons for at least 8 seconds or until you see the OPPO logo. Alternatively, press and hold the Power button and tap/ slide [Restart]. Then, please check if the issue is resolved. Update system to the latest version Go to [Settings] > [Software Updates] / [System Updates] / [About Device]. Reset your OPPO phone to system settings Check this link to learn How to Factory Reset an OPPO Phone. How to Send a Group Message on Your OPPO Smartphone?
Applicable products:SmartphonesSystem version:No system version involved
How to Send a Group Message on Your OPPO Smartphone? You have an announcement, a quote, or some messages you want to send to a group of people. Rather than individually sending an SMS, your OPPO phone will let you send messages to multiple recipients. Check the easy steps here! Applicable to: All OPPO Smartphones. Send a group message Tap [Messages] on the Home screen, create a new message, and choose the recipients from one of the following lists: From Contacts: tick the contacts you wish to include in the group message, then tap [Add]. From Groups: tick the groups you wish to include in the group message, then tap [Add]. From Call Log: tick the ones you've recently called or who has recently called you, then tap [Add]. If you want to send the message to recipients who are not in your contacts list, tap [Message] on the Home screen, create a new message, enter a phone number, and tap [Done]. Repeat the above steps to add multiple recipients. After selecting the recipients, type a message, and tap [Send]. To view the recipients, tap the icon in the upper-right corner of the screen. If you can send messages but have issues with a group message For models of ColorOS 3.2 and below, go to [Settings] > [App Management] > [All] and find Messages. Tap Messages, then clear its data and cache. For models of ColorOS 5.0 and above, long-press the icon of [Messages] > [App Info] > [Storage Usage], then clear its data and cache. Restart the phone, and update it to the latest software version. Take out the SIM card and put it back in, and see if you fixed the issue. * Pictures, settings, and paths might differ from those of your phone, but these won't affect the description in this article.

Can I Use One SIM Card in a Dual SIM Phone Do you own an OPPO smartphone with dual SIM capabilities but only use one SIM card? No worries! Your phone will still perform exceptionally well even with just one SIM. In this technical article, we'll explore the advantages of dual SIM phones, their functionalities, and why it's perfectly fine to operate with just a single SIM. Dual SIM Functionality Dual SIM smartphones, as the name suggests, can accommodate and operate with two separate SIM cards simultaneously. This feature is designed to provide users with enhanced connectivity options, the ability to manage personal and work contacts separately, or even use SIM cards from different service providers. How Does a Dual SIM Phone Work with a Single SIM Card If you possess a dual SIM OPPO phone but use only one SIM card, your phone will operate perfectly with the inserted SIM. The phone will recognize the available SIM and function as a single SIM phone, utilizing the inserted SIM for calls, messages, and data connectivity. Benefits of Using a Dual SIM Phone with a Single SIM Card Backup Storage: The unused SIM card slot can be a backup storage option for your SIM card. Having a backup SIM ready can be incredibly convenient in case of misplacement or damage to your primary SIM. Future-Proofing: Circumstances may change even if you currently use only one SIM card. Having a second SIM slot means you're ready to utilize another SIM if the need arises without requiring a new phone. Separate Work and Personal: If you ever decide to use the second SIM, you can easily have a work and personal number on the same device, providing more organized communication options. Unable to Screen Record During Calls on OPPO Phone
Applicable products:SmartphonesSystem version:ColorOS 14 and above,ColorOS 11.1 and above,ColorOS 5.0-7.2,ColorOS 11 and above,ColorOS 12 and above
In OPPO, we value our user's privacy. When attempting to use the screen recording feature during a phone call, a prompt "Unable to record screen because another app is using the microphone" will be displayed to safeguard your privacy even if the "Record microphone sound" setting is enabled for the screen recording feature. This measure ensures that no unauthorized access to your microphone occurs during a call recording. Why can't I use the screen record while on call Recording the audio during a phone call raises privacy concerns, and relevant policies state that call audio recording is prohibited. How to Make a Conference Call Using Your OPPO Smartphone?
Applicable products:SmartphonesSystem version:No system version involved
How to Make a Conference Call Using Your OPPO Smartphone? Want to add more people to your phone call? Have a conference call on your OPPO phone. Check the requirement and the easy steps to make a conference call. Situation: You need to talk to a few people at the same time without leaving your location. Applicable to: ColorOS 5.2 and above devices. Conference call allows you to have a conversation or meeting with multiple people at the same time. Note: The conference call host may incur call charges for each call participant and long-distance charges for distant calls. Follow these steps to make a conference call: 1. Contact your carrier and enable the conference call feature. 2. When you're in a call, tap [Add Call] > Make another call. 3. Once the second call is connected, tap on [Merge Calls]. 4. Repeat the same steps to add more calls to the conference. You can merge up to 6 calls for conference calls including the host if your carrier supports the feature. * Pictures, settings, and paths might differ from those of your phone, but these won't affect the description in this article.
When receiving multiple calls from unknown numbers, it can be disruptive to your daily phone usage. Here is a way to block a caller ID in your OPPO smartphone that would recognize the blacklisted number and automatically reject calls from them. It's an easy tool to keep those unwanted callers out of your mind and lets you continue enjoying your OPPO phone! Read on! Note: Check your phone's ColorOS version in [Settings] > [About Phone] / [About Device]. Blocklist a contact on OPPO phone Know how to block a contact on your OPPO phone's Phone dialer app and Google Phone app: OPPO Phone dialer Block calls The Block calls feature helps you to prevent unwanted phone calls from reaching you. For ColorOS 12 to ColorOS 13: Open the [Phone] app > tap a contact, tap the [Setting] button and choose [Block numbers] to add it to the blocklist. For ColorOS 11: Go to [Settings] > [Privacy] > [Block & Filter] > [Block Calls]. Alternatively, go to and tap in the upper right corner > [Block & Filter]. For ColorOS 6.1: Go to [Settings] > [System Apps] > [Call] > [Block & Filter] > [Call Blocking]. Alternatively, go to [Settings] > [Security] > [Block & Filter] > [Call Blocking]. For ColorOS 5.1 to 6.0: Go to [Settings] > [System Apps] > [Call] > [Block] > [Call Blocking]. Alternatively, go to [Settings] > [Security] > [Anti-harassment/Fraud] > [Call Blocking]. For ColorOS 5.0: Go to [Settings] > [Call] > [Block] > [Block Calls]. Alternatively, go to [Settings] > [Security] > [Anti-harassment/Fraud] > [Block Calls]. For ColorOS 3.2: Go to [Settings] > [Call] > [Block] > [Block Calls]. Alternatively, go to [Settings] > [Security] > [Anti-harassment/Fraud] > [Block Calls]. For ColorOS 3.1: Go to [Settings] > [Call] > [Block] > [Block Calls]. Alternatively, go to [Settings] > [Security] > [Block] > [Block Calls]. For ColorOS 3.0: Go to [Settings] > [Call] > [Block]. Rules available for blocking incoming calls: Block All Calls: You won't receive calls anymore unless there are calls from VIP contacts or white-listed numbers. Block All Calls from Unknown Numbers: The unknown number refers to an unsaved real phone number. Please be aware that when you turn this function on, you might miss some important phone calls from new numbers. Block Unknown Numbers by Region: You can block numbers from specific locations. Block One-Ring Calls: This ONLY applies to unknown numbers. Block Calls from Hidden Numbers: You can block calls made from private numbers. Note: The above rules may vary depending on the ColorOS version. Some rules may not be available on certain devices. Block messages The Block messages feature will let you control the text and MMS messages you will receive. For ColorOS 12 and above: Open the [Messages] app and tap on the [Three-dotted] icon > [Block & filter] > [Three-dotted] icon again > [Block & filter] > [Block messages] > choose which messages to block. You can also set [Custom blocked words] > tap on [+] icon to add > type in the word you want to block > tap [Ok]. For ColorOS 7.0 to 11.3: Go to [Settings] > [Privacy] > [Block & Filter] > [Block Messages], or go to the [Messages] app > tap the 2-dots icon in the upper right corner > [Block & Filter] > [Blocked Messages] > tap the 2-dots icon in the upper right corner > [Set Rules] > [Block Messages]. For ColorOS 6.1: Go to [Settings] > [System Apps] > [Messages] > [Block & Filter] > [Block Messages], or go to [Settings] > [Security] > [Block & Filter] > [Block Messages]. For ColorOS 5.1: Go to ColorOS 6.0. Go to [Settings] > [System Apps] > [Call] > [Block] > [Block Messages], or go to [Settings] > [Security] > [Anti-harassment/Fraud] > [Block Messages]. For ColorOS 5.0: Go to [Settings] > [Messages] > [Block] > [Block Messages], or go to [Settings] > [Security] > [Anti-harassment/Fraud] > [Block Messages]. For ColorOS 3.2: Go to [Settings] > [Messages] > [Block] > [Block Messages], or go to [Settings] > [Security] > [Anti-harassment/Fraud] > [Block Messages]. For ColorOS 3.1: Go to [Settings] > [Messages] > [Block] > [Block Messages], or go to [Settings] > [Security] > [Block] > [Block Messages]. For ColorOS 3.0: Go to [Settings] > [Messages] > [Block]. Set rules to block messages Keywords for Spam: Messages from unknown numbers containing particular keywords that you have set will be recognized as spam. Block Messages from Unknown Numbers: All messages from unknown numbers that are not in your contact list will be blocked. Note: When Block Messages from Unknown Messages are turned on, you might miss important verification text messages, as well as messages from people who you know, but are not on your contact list. Manage to block messages per SIM Note: This option is only available on phones using dual SIM cards. For dual SIM phones, while on the message blocking screen, you can tap SIM 1 or SIM 2 and customize the message blocking rules. Google Phone dialer Block calls and messages On your OPPO phone, go to the [Phone] app and tap the [three-dotted line] at the top right, then tap [Settings] > [Blocked numbers] and toggle [Unknown] to block calls from unidentified callers. Alternatively, you can add a phone number to block calls from it by going to the [Phone] app and tapping the [Three-dotted line] at the top right, then tap [Settings] > [Blocked numbers] > [Add a Phone Number] and enter the phone number you want to block, then tap [Block].
